Mystiq25: What should I do to prevent my redmi 8a from closing apps please? I can't open at least two apps simultaneously without one app closed by the phone. Anyone with a solution please? |
Re: The Xiaomi Thread. by genius43(m): 6:29am On Feb 23, 2021 |
mhiztalee: Quick Charge heats up phone so it is normal, that is why you are advised not to use your phone why Charging. |
Re: The Xiaomi Thread. by genius43(m): 6:33am On Feb 23, 2021 |
Mystiq25: You should know that currently 2GB RAM is small in the current dispensation and MIUI is aggressive in killing processes to improve battery life and as well reduce operational lags. You can lock few apps to the memory |
